A seven-year-old pilot will represent the UAE at the upcoming Dubai Masters RC Championship.
Nasser Ahmed Nasser is the world's youngest pilot of professional remote-controlled planes and has been chosen as one of five who'll represent the country at the event, which will feature some of the best RC pilots from around the world.
There will be a total prize purse of $70,000, that's around AED 257,000, and if Nasser wins his race he'll pocket almost AED 28,000.
The Dubai Masters RC Championship takes place at the Skyhub RC campus in Al Lisaili from February 23-27.
